Business LLC & DBA - Two Separate Entities?

Question: We have a Business LLC whose EIN number is to be used on a new business account. However, they are DBA another Business Name, Inc. Don't we need a Certificate of Assumed Name, as they are two separate entities?
Answer: There are probably not two separate entities involved. It's likely that this is a garden-variety "doing business as" situation. John Doe DBA Doe's Dart Emporium; Business LLC DBA Corner Apothecary; Doctors Associates, Inc., DBA Subway Sandwich Restaurants. You may need to obtain evidence of an assumed name filing, depending on your state's laws on such things. That provides documentation that the business has the right to use the assumed name in trade and helps prevent someone from taking over a business's name with a DBA to defraud that business or its customers.
